  • Patent number: 8152411
    Abstract: Guide arrangement for marine risers, in particular for offshore oil and gas operations. The guide arrangement has at least one guide structure (21, 22) for a length of riser, a frame assembly (10, 10A-D) for supporting said guide structure, anchor means (11, 12) at the seabed, tether means (13, 14) connecting said frame assembly to said anchor means, and a buoyancy element (1) for keeping said guide structure (21, 22) at a desired level in the sea during operation. The guide structure (21, 22) is pivotably supported by said frame assembly (10, 10A-D) with a pivot axis (21P, 22P) being substantially horizontal.

  • Patent number: 7241075
    Abstract: A subsea cable (3) designed to extend from a floating structure (1) on the sea surface down to a subsea structure (2) on the sea floor with a first portion (3a) extending from the floating structure (1) to the sea floor and a second portion (3b) laid in or on the sea floor has an outer sheath and cables and/or conduits inside said outer sheath. The second portion (3b) of the subsea cable (3) is provided with at least one disc-shaped anchor (4) attached to the subsea cable (3b) with clamps. The at least one disc-shaped anchor (4) makes movement of the second portion (3b) more difficult.

  • Patent number: 6943300
    Abstract: A flexible electrical elongated device is provided, suitable for service in a high mechanical load environment. The device has a longitudinal axis, and at least one elongated electrical conductor element. The device further has an elongated load bearing component along the longitudinal axis and has an external surface including at least one groove disposed along the longitudinal axis. The groove is designed for holding the conductor element within it while allowing the conductor element to move substantially radially when the device is bent.
